Quick Summary
The Department of the Air Force is issuing a Sole Source Combined Synopsis/Solicitation for the Launch and Early Orbit, Anomaly Resolution and Disposal Operations (LADO) Follow-On program. This requirement is for software, hardware, and engineering services to sustain the LADO system, which supports non-operational GPS satellites. The contract is being awarded to Parsons Government Services due to their proprietary AcePremier software, essential for LADO functionality. Offers are due by February 4, 2026, at 05:00 PM MST.
Scope of Work
The contractor will provide comprehensive engineering services for LADO sustainment, including:
- Support for Telemetry, Tracking, and Commanding (TT&C), Core Applications, Orbit Determination, and Simulation Software.
- Provision and maintenance of software licenses, upgrades, and modifications.
- Maintenance of classified and unclassified development environments.
- Software engineering tasks (C++ coding, error correction, capability additions).
- 24/7 on-site or on-call support for surge periods.
- Cybersecurity support, vulnerability assessments, and compliance with DoD policies.
- Project management, budget development, and status reporting.
- Delivery of numerous Contract Data Requirements List (CDRL) items, including Quality Assurance Program Plan, Monthly Status Reports, Technical Manuals, Software User Manuals, Software Test Plans, Configuration Management Plans, and a Phase-Out Transition Plan.
- Maintenance of Line Replaceable Units (LRUs)/Front-End Processors (FEPs).

Important Notes
This is a sole source acquisition justified under FAR Part 6.302-1(a)(2)(iii) because Parsons Government Services owns the proprietary AcePremier software, which is critical for the LADO system. The LADO program is slated for decommissioning by October 2026, with the Next Generation Operation Control System (OCX) intended as its replacement, but OCX has experienced delays. Parsons has indicated no interest in selling data rights for AcePremier.
